A friend asked me to help sell her father's 4" Security Six. She brought it over last night so I could check it out. It's a low mileage gun. Very low mileage. I know there has only been one round fired (into the floor) in the last 16 years. The 157- number decodes to a 1981 gun. There is no box and the original grips were replaced with Pachmyers.
The gun itself is really clean. I broke it down last night and there was very little residue inside. The mechanical bits were clean with no appreciable wear. There are a couple mild scratches on the side of the hammer but it's not heavy like my high round count guns.
The bluing has been slightly worn at the muzzle and, sadly, the gun was dropped on it's sights. The front sight had a little burr on it as did the body (not the blade) of the rear sight. I dressed them last night but did not touch up the finish.
Any ideas of the value of something like this?
She's hurting for cash and I'd feel bad about a low ball offer.
